SortPooling (k) [source] ¶. Bases: torch.nn.modules.module.Module Sort Pooling from An End-to-End Deep Learning Architecture for Graph Classification. It first sorts the node features in ascending order along the feature dimension, and selects the sorted features of top-k nodes (ranked by the … eastman raptorWebCreate the convolutional base. The 6 lines of code below define the convolutional base using a common pattern: a stack of Conv2D and MaxPooling2D layers. As input, a CNN takes tensors of shape (image_height, image_width, color_channels), ignoring the batch size. If you are new to these dimensions, color_channels refers to (R,G,B). eastman radiatorsWebMar 28, 2024 · A Computer Science portal for geeks.
